TAKE-TWO DISPELLS XBOX GTA3 IN MAY RUMOUR
Rumours on the \'net are rife about the hit PS2 game coming to Microsoft\'s console in May, but do they hold water? They\'re leaking like a stuck pig, according to publisher Take-Two
13:53 Sure as eggs are eggs, PS2 owners must be sniggering to themselves in the dark recesses of their bedroom corners when they hear the euphoric cries from owners of other next gen machines about the arrival of GTA 3 on their chosen console. The crime-based smash has been out on Sony\'s box since October 2001, and the nearest sniff any other hardware has had is the news that it will be out on PC in either April or May this year.
Rumours about the imminent arrival of an Xbox version have stemmed from the fact that e-commerce site Amazon.co.uk is allowing you to pre-order Grand Theft Auto 3 for its arrival in May 2002. On Xbox. Apparently. However, according to Take-Two, an Xbox version doesn\'t currently exist in any official form.
"GTA 3 was a massive hit on PlayStation 2, and it seems that people are simply expecting it to appear on other next-generation platforms," a spokesperson for the publisher told us today. "At the moment we\'re concentrating on the PC version of Grand Theft Auto 3, which we\'re aiming to have out in April or May this year." So how about the rumoured Xbox version? "There\'s simply nothing to talk about at this time," the spokesperson said.
While this doesn\'t necessarily mean that GTA 3 won\'t be coming to Xbox at some point, it looks as though Amazon.co.uk\'s date of 31st May 2002 could be a tad optimistic.
